These revisions arise against the orders of learned III Additional District and Sessions Judge, Gopichettipalayam, passed in I.A.Nos.891 and 892 of 2013 in O.S.No.241 of 2013 on 08.01.2016.
2. Petitioner/plaintiff has moved O.S.No.241 of 2013 on the file of learned III Additional District and Sessions Judge, Gopichettipalayam, seeking a declaration that the sale deed in respect of 'C' schedule property executed by defendants 1 and 2 in favour of defendants 3 and 4 is null and void and for other consequential reliefs. Therein, he had moved I.A.Nos.891 and 892 of 2013 complaining of acts of disturbance caused to his possession of property, intent of defendants to encumber the same and sought interim injunction. The Court below had treated such applications as closed informing that the case stood posted for trial. There against, these revisions have been filed.
3. Heard learned counsel for petitioner.
4. Learned counsel for petitioner submits that in a collusive action, third
party interest has been created over the property and such persons are now interfering with the petitioner's possession. The Civil Revision Petitions shall stand disposed of with the observation that it would be open to petitioner/plaintiff to move the Court below afresh by way of interlocutory application informing the change of circumstance and seek remedy at the hands of such Court. Any application so moved shall be dealt with by the Court below on merits and with expedition. The Court below may deal likewise with the suit. No costs. Consequently, connected miscellaneous petitions are closed.
